QmlDesigner: Add ProjectStorage::signalDeclarationNames

As we changed the MetaInfo interface we can return ids too but as an
intermediate step we return the sorted signal names. Beware that the
sort is not matching the normal SmallString "<" operator because it is
not using size.

mutable ReadStatement<1, 1> selectSignalDeclarationNamesForTypeStatement{
"WITH RECURSIVE "
" typeChain(typeId) AS ("
" VALUES(?1)"
" UNION ALL "
" SELECT prototypeId FROM types JOIN typeChain "
" USING(typeId) WHERE prototypeId IS NOT NULL)"
"SELECT name FROM typeChain JOIN signalDeclarations "
" USING(typeId) ORDER BY name",
database};
